Abstract
The goal is to research and identify drought-sensitive points in the Ninh Thuan area by combining the Fuzzy Analytic Network Process (FANP) and GIS with the precipitation, temperature, and vegetation indices. To study temperature index and vegetation, the author uses remote sensing image data for the period 2006 -2016 from the United States Geological Survey (USGS) on the image background of Landsat 5 and 8. Based on input data, the study has built maps of the Rainfall Anomaly Index (RAI), Standard Precipitation Index (SPI), Water supply vegetation index (WSVI), Vegetation Health Index (VHI), Normalized Difference Vegetation Index (NDVI), Soil Adjusted Vegetation Index (SAVI), and Normalized difference water index (NDWI). Through the FANP model, the research has ranked the indicators from 1 to 8 by the supper matrix. The results show that the weights of the indicates are calculated based on the FANP matrix as follows: WSVI is 19.5%, VHI is 16.3%, VCI is 15.4%, SAVI is 13.8%, NDVI is 12.2%, NDWI is 10.3%, SPI 6.9%, and RAI is 5.6%. Based on ranking, the study has been successfully built and identified areas with drought sensitivity according to 5 levels, from no drought to extreme drought. Research results are the basis for using multiple-criteria decision-making (MCDM) in drought research and related fields.
